Total Student Population Comparison
The total student population of selected colleges is 7,568 with 4,283 female students and 3,285 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Davenport University has the most enrolled students of 5,073, while Yeshiva Gedolah of Greater Detroit has the least number of students of 68 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.
Name | Total | Men | Women |
---|---|---|---|
Alma College | 1,260 | 588 | 672 |
Davenport University | 5,073 | 2,164 | 2,909 |
Rochester University | 1,167 | 465 | 702 |
Yeshiva Gedolah of Greater Detroit | 68 | 68 | - |
Moody Theological Seminary and Graduate School--Michigan | - | - | - |
Baker College of Muskegon | - | - | - |
Total | 7,568 | 3,285 | 4,283 |
Undergraduate Student Population
The total undergraduate population of selected colleges is 6,522 with 3,648 female students and 2,874 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 undergradu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Davenport University has the most enrolled undergraduate students of 4,069, while Yeshiva Gedolah of Greater Detroit has the least number of undergraduate students of 68.
Name | Total | Men | Women |
---|---|---|---|
Alma College | 1,245 | 582 | 663 |
Davenport University | 4,069 | 1,778 | 2,291 |
Rochester University | 1,140 | 446 | 694 |
Yeshiva Gedolah of Greater Detroit | 68 | 68 | - |
Total | 6,522 | 2,874 | 3,648 |
Graduate Student Population
The total graduate population of selected colleges is 1,046 with 635 female students and 411 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 gradu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Davenport University has the most enrolled graduate students of 1,004, while Alma College has the least number of graduate students of 15.
Name | Total | Men | Women |
---|---|---|---|
Alma College | 15 | 6 | 9 |
Davenport University | 1,004 | 386 | 618 |
Rochester University | 27 | 19 | 8 |
Total | 1,046 | 411 | 635 |
